INDIA-MARTYR'S DAY-GANDHI

Indian social worker Sham Lal Gandhi carries a photograph of Mahatma Gandhi and transports a 'charkha' - spinning wheel - on his bicycle on the occasion of Martyr's Day in Amritsar on January 30, 2013, the 65th anniversary of Gandhi's assassination. Mahatma Gandhi was on the way to a prayer meeting in the Indian capital New Delhi when he was shot three times in the chest and head on January 30, 1948.
